Trad. Simp. Pinyin English
cuò be obstructed; fail; oppress; repress; lower the tone; bend back; dampen
挫敗 挫败 cuò bài thwart; defeat; foil (someone's plans, etc)
挫折 cuò zhé setback; reverse
挫折感 cuò zhé gǎn (n) frustration

